Purdue University in Indiana is another gem when it comes to aviation studies. With a strong legacy in aviation technology, Purdue has produced some of the most renowned figures in the field, including Neil Armstrong, the first man on the moon.
The aviation program at Purdue blends hands-on flight training with solid academic learning. Students train in modern aircraft while also gaining exposure to air traffic control, aviation safety, and aerospace engineering. What sets Purdue apart is its focus on both the technical and leadership aspects of aviation.
Many students find themselves working for major airlines or moving into roles within the Federal Aviation Administration (FAA). Purdue’s reputation ensures that graduates are respected across the aviation industry. It’s not just about flying—it’s about becoming a leader in aviation.
